Minutes — Management Meeting, Velmora Group. Attendees: full executive team. Single agenda item: term sheet from partner Quenby Holdings. Valuation acceptable; governance clauses need revision. Counsel to redline exclusivity and board-seat provisions by Friday. Marta Ollen to lead negotiation; fallback position agreed verbally. Vote: proceed, unanimous. Next review at the Harlowe offsite. The confidential note below summarizes the board-approved negotiating posture.

confidential, kagup-bafog: Fraaxax Group is in early talks to buy Soroxox Group for about $343.8 million. The Olidor launch date is June 14, and nothing goes to the press before then. Legal wants the Aldmirek Logistics term sheet signed before July 23.

**Ticket: Timezone offsets wrong in scheduled report exports**

Reports generated by the Mirelight export service apply UTC offsets from the server locale rather than the workspace setting, shifting daily totals for customers east of the datum. Reproduced on the current release candidate; fix is staged and verified in Harrowgate QA. The affected build token appears below.

pipeline stamp: htk3_cc5

# Break-Glass: Catalog Cache Invalidation

Scope: the Pinrow product catalog at Veldstone Retail. If stale prices persist after a purge and the Hollowmere invalidation queue is wedged, use break-glass to flush the edge tier directly. Contractors: get verbal sign-off from the catalog lead first. Steps: open the Hollowmere admin shell, select emergency-flush, confirm the tenant, and run it once — repeated flushes thrash the origin. Access is logged and expires after 20 minutes. Unseal the admin shell with the passphrase below.

recovery phrase for kahop-tajog: istix-casvan

Supplier Strategy — Managers Only

This page tracks the search for a second source for the Korvane actuator used across the Peltrix range. Our sole supplier, Drummond Forgeworks, remains reliable but exposed to capacity constraints at its Ashvale site. Three candidates have passed initial audits; Brenholt Precision scored highest on tooling readiness. Qualification builds start next quarter. Board members should note the commercial rationale stated below.

management briefing: The renewal with Zoraelax Group closes at $10 million a year, 15 percent below the last contract. Project Ralael slips by six weeks because of the audit delay.